The Commercial Manager will provide specialized knowledge in overseeing the commercial strategy on a project. This role collaborates with the senior operations team to develop and implement a commercial management system that drives performance and minimizes risk to the business.
What You’ll Do Here
- Change management, including schedule interpretation and claims administration
- Implement an effective system to ensure contractually-required notices are delivered to the client per the project agreement terms
- Administer project contracts (project agreement, subcontracts, consultancy agreements, purchase agreements, etc.), ensuring deliverables and timelines are met while minimizing commercial risk
- Lead drafting, review, and negotiation of contracts with clients and subcontractors to optimize financial, legal, risk, and reputational positions
- Implement and monitor procurement scheduling and plans; facilitate the tendering process for materials, goods, services and equipment; develop terms and conditions, scope, and specifications; oversee bidding with pre-qualified companies; evaluate bids and provide tender analyses and recommendations
- Issue regular reporting and analytics on commercial issues to Executives and Project Managers
- Engage with insurance advisors to develop project insurance programs and coverages
- Consult with legal advisors as needed
- Manage project close-out, including defect liability period and operations & maintenance considerations
- Lead and align a team of commercial direct reports with project priorities, ensuring accountability for results
- Maintain a good understanding of finance, accounting and project reporting
